How Hydrafacial Technology Works Hydrafacial is also magic because of its Vortex-Fusion technology that is patented. This system has a spiral suction tip to cause a vortex effect and that removes debris off pores and at the same time, it injects the skin with nourishing serums. Hydrafacial has gentle suction that removes the congested pores without inflicting trauma as opposed to aggressive extractions that may leave the skin reddened or sore. Meanwhile, the deep penetration of antioxidants, peptides and hyaluronic acid ensures skin hydration and remediation. The Science Behind Vortex-Fusion Technology The Vortex-Fusion technology is based on a simple and powerful principle; clean and nourish both. Conventional facials usually exfoliate the skin followed by the use of products which may lower the absorption. Hydrafacial flips that touch the skin by keeping it always moist during the procedure. This improves serum penetration, cellular turnover, and longevity of skin health as opposed to providing an immediate high. The Hydrafacial Procedure: Step-by-Step Experience An average Hydrafacial treatment involves exfoliation and cleansing of the skin to help get rid of dead cells. This is then succeeded with a mild peel of the skin that removes debris in the pores without peeling. Then there is the painless removal through the suction technology. Last but not least, the skin is impregnated with hydrating and protective serums. The whole procedure is pleasant, calming and efficient. Is Hydrafacial Suitable for All Skin Types? How Often Should You Get a Hydrafacial? https://ojasclinic.com Dermatologists generally recommend getting a Hydrafacial once a month for optimal results. This frequency helps maintain clear pores, balanced hydration, and healthy skin turnover. However, the exact schedule may vary depending on individual skin concerns and goals. Are There Any Side Effects or Risks? Hydrafacial is considered very safe, especially when performed by trained professionals. Some people may experience mild redness immediately after the treatment, but this usually subsides within a few hours. There is no downtime, making it ideal for busy lifestyles.
